Transaction 9381221d1f3a6d6a2a119c615f84ed84bc94bb62aabedb45d30605b45a3860ed
1 Input
1 Output
-
9381221d1f3a6d6a2a119c615f84ed84bc94bb62aabedb45d30605b45a3860ed:0
- value
- 28296976
- script pubkey
- OP_0 OP_PUSHBYTES_20 095c7af815832bb6d0db36257fbdb19097d5aa84
- address
- bc1qp9w847q4sv4md5xmxcjhl0d3jztat25ycs2ks5